placon launches new ecostar plastics website

the redesigned ecostar website focuses on the sustainable benefits of using, and recycling, postconsumer pet rollstock for thermoformed packaging.madison, wi prweb january 27, 2015placon, a north american leader in the design and manufacture of rigid plastic packaging for the food, retail and medical device markets is pleased to announce the launch of its new, responsive ecostar plastics website. new to the site is a pet 101 section that provides fun yet educational information geared towards the benefits of thermoforming postconsumer polyethylene terepthalate pet for packaging and recycling it for reuse.the ecostar facility reclaims, recycles and extrudes postconsumer recycled pcr rollstock from curbside collected pet bottles and thermoforms for new thermoforming applications. the site showcases the company&rsquos 100 recyclable range of pet rollstock options including up to 100 highclarity pcr pet for thermoform food, retail and nonsterile medical trays, clamshells and blister applications. ecostar&rsquos &ldquoclosed loop&rdquo sustainability message is woven throughout the site conveying the company&rsquos clear stance on recycling pet for continuous use and reuse in order to reduce pet packaging waste to landfills.&ldquothe ecominded consumer is interested in what their packaging is made out of, and more importantly, whether it is sustainable and recyclable, &ldquostates laura stewart, vp of sales and marketing. &ldquothe new site is intended to help educate brand owners and their customers on the importance of using and recycling postconsumer pet thermoformed packaging.&rdquocontinues stewart, &ldquowe wanted to build a site that our customers can use to inform and educate their end users on why postconsumer recycled pet is a responsible material choice for packaging as well as the value in recycling the packaging for continuous reuse.&rdquoabout ecostarecostar is a north american recycler and extruder of highclarity, thingauge rigid pet rollstock for thermoformed food, retail and nonsterile medical packaging applications. one of the largest in the midwest, the wibased ecostar facility reclaims and recycles over 1 billion curbside collected plastic bottles and thermoforms a year, extruding them into ultra clear, sustainable pet rollstock that is 100 recyclable. for more information, visit httpwww.ecostarplastics.com.about placonfor over 45 years placon has been a leading designer and manufacturer of plastic packaging with a line of ecostar&reg branded postconsumer recycled rollstock from pet bottles and thermoforms. continuously setting the bar in plastic packaging solutions, placon produces innovative custom packaging , quality plastic clamshells, high clarity thermoformed and injection molded food, and protective medical device products that harness the power of tomorrow&rsquos technology and design to solve customers&rsquo challenges today. for more information, visit httpwww.placon.com.&nbsp
